If you’re a salmon lover, you might have considered brining your fish to add some flavor and moisture to it. However, after brining, the question that arises is – how long should you dry the salmon before cooking it?
Firstly, let’s understand the concept of brining. Brining involves soaking the salmon in a saltwater solution for a certain period of time. This process helps in adding flavor and moisture to the fish, making it tender and juicy when cooked.
Now coming to drying the fish after brining, it is an essential step that should not be overlooked. Drying the salmon helps in forming a pellicle on its surface, which is a thin layer of protein. This layer helps in retaining moisture while cooking and gives the fish a beautiful texture.
So how long should you dry your salmon after brining it? Well, there are two ways to go about it – air-drying or using a fan.
If you’re air-drying your salmon, which is the most common method, you should let it dry for at least 2-4 hours at room temperature. Place the salmon on a wire rack or parchment paper-lined baking sheet and leave it uncovered. Ensure that there is enough space between each piece for air circulation.
On the other hand, if you’re using a fan to dry your salmon, place the fish in front of a fan for 1-2 hours until a pellicle forms on its surface.
It’s important to note that drying time may vary depending on factors such as humidity and temperature. If you’re living in a humid area or during summers, drying time may be longer than usual.
In conclusion, drying your salmon after brining is an essential step that cannot be skipped. The amount of time required for drying may vary depending on various factors but generally speaking 2-4 hours of air-drying or 1-2 hours of fan-drying should suffice.
